Cloudflare
NET
#419
Rank
ยฃ39.04 B
Marketcap
ยฃ113.77
Share price
-1.92%
Change (1 day)
75.79%
Change (1 year)
Cloudflare, Inc. is an American company that provides a content delivery network, Internet security, and distributed Domain Name Server (DNS) services.

We have found no dividend yield history for this company